Cornwall Junior Cup

Penzance Reserves 0-5 Troon

Att - 61

Unbeaten Troon were too good for Penzance who tried but could not break their visitors back 5 and keeper. 

Troon 3-0 up at half time, eased off a bit but were still able to snuff out the host's attack.

Pz played too long, no goals from about 4-5 chances, Troon on the break, 5 goals from 7 chances. that was the difference.

Good luck Troon in future rounds.

Jubilee cup result.   Att- 30 
Pendeen Rovers Reserves (5)Storm (4)

3-1 HT 

Not really sure where to start with a report as,let’s just say,this wasn’t the most fluent we’ve been…with a few of our normal starters missing for various reasons,we never really got into our stride and our passing game was missing from the outset. Play either broke down in the final third or we resorted to route one,playing the channels for someone to provide that bit of magic..goals from Leon Dixon again(from the penalty spot) and a brace from Toby Angwin gave us what should of been a comfortable 3-1 lead at halftime. Second half started with Storm pushing for the next goal and for about 20-25 minutes it was ridiculously scrappy,they were first to every ball and were well up for the fight,and we,at times,just rolled over… This didn’t really aid my greying hair problem or help with my foul language as storm kept coming back again and again before goals from Charlie Strick and Mefin slade finally sealed the win. NOT a good day at the office but (as they say) a wins a win and we’re into the next round 🏆 good luck to storm for their season and great to see their whole squad back in the North Inn afterwards,thanks again to them for their wonderful hospitality. Three away trips on the bounce now,let’s hope we improve on this weeks performance but keep getting the results..🖤💛🖤💛
